Blade Steel – PIKAS Master Chef’s Knives
PIKAS Master chef’s knives are crafted from high-quality, stainless chrome-molybdenum-vanadium steel and traditionally forged using drop hammers – just like over 100 years ago. This forging technique not only gives the blade exceptional hardness but also impressive edge retention and extreme sharpness. Whether cutting meat, vegetables, or fish – you’ll enjoy a precise and effortless cutting experience at a professional level.Handles – PIKAS Master Chef’s Knives
The ergonomically shaped handles are made from high-quality POM plastic, known for its heat resistance, dimensional stability, and easy care. They provide a secure grip even during extended cooking sessions. The perfect balance between handle and blade ensures controlled cuts without fatigue. The inlaid PIKAS logo made of solid brass is not only a refined detail but also a symbol of quality, tradition, and true craftsmanship from Solingen.Care – PIKAS Master Chef’s Knives
Clean your PIKAS Master knives with water after use and avoid putting them in the dishwasher or leaving them in water for extended periods to protect both blade and handle. For optimal care and long-lasting sharpness, we recommend using our special knife oil.Application – PIKAS Master Chef’s Knives
